Supreme court rejects Trump’s mail ballot restrictions for midterm elections

The Guardian · The Hill

The US Supreme Court has rejected the Trump administration's attempt to restrict mail ballots for the upcoming midterm elections, declining to lift a lower court's block and allowing states to continue using established processes over two dissents.

  • The US Supreme Court rejected Trump administration mail ballot restrictions.
  • States are permitted to continue sending out mail ballots under long-standing processes.
  • The Supreme Court refused to clear the way for the administration's mail-in voting plan.
  • Two conservative justices dissented from the high court's decision.
